
Bubble Sort - Python - GeeksforGeeks
Feb 21, 2025 · def bubble_sort(arr): # Outer loop to iterate through the list n times for n in range(len(arr) - 1, 0, -1): # Initialize swapped to track if any swaps occur swapped = False # Inner loop to compare adjacent elements for i in range(n): if arr[i] > arr[i + 1]: # Swap elements if they are in the wrong order arr[i], arr[i + 1] = arr[i + 1], arr[i ...
Python Program for Bubble Sort - Tutorial Gateway
In this section, we show how to write a Python Program to arrange List items using Bubble sort for loop, while loop & function with example.
Python Program For Bubble Sort [3 Methods]
Oct 12, 2023 · Understanding what bubble sorting is, how we can write a Python program for bubble sort using three different methods for loop, while loop, and list comprehension.
codehs-python/2.10.4 Bubble Wrap 2.0.py at main - GitHub
Now add a function that will draw a white highlight on each bubble. """ speed (0) # This function will draw one row of 10 circles def draw_circle_row (): for i in range (10): pendown () begin_fill …
CodeHS-Python/BubbleWrap2.0.py at main - GitHub
Now add a function that will draw a white highlight on each bubble. """ speed (0) # This function will draw one row of 10 circles def draw_circle_row (): for i in range (10): pendown () begin_fill () color ("light blue") circle (20) end_fill () penup () forward (40) make_highlight () # This function will move Tracy from end of row up ...
How exactly does the loop within a bubble sort algorithm work? (Python ...
Sep 18, 2018 · Example code: def bubble_sort (my_list): n = len (my_list) for i in range (n): for j in range (0, n - 1 - i): if my_list [j] > my_list [j + 1]: my_list [j],
Python Bubble Sort with Loops - CodePal
This function implements the bubble sort algorithm using loops to sort an array of integers in ascending order. Bubble sort is a simple sorting algorithm that repeatedly steps through the …
Bubble Sort in Python: A Step-by-Step Guide - Medium
Aug 17, 2024 · Let’s break down the bubble sort algorithm with clear examples and code implementation in Python. This guide helps you understand the logic and implementation of bubble sort in a concise,...
Python For Loops - W3Schools
To loop through a set of code a specified number of times, we can use the range () function, The range () function returns a sequence of numbers, starting from 0 by default, and increments by 1 (by default), and ends at a specified number.
Bubble Sort Program in Python
Dec 22, 2022 · The bubble sort algorithm compares adjacent elements and swaps them to sort the list. The bubble sort uses two for loops to sort the list. The first for loop (outer for loop) is used to traverse the list n times. The Second for loop (inner for loop) is used to traverse the list and swap elements if necessary. Bubble Sort Algorithm Python:-
- Some results have been removed